Vodacom South Africa and the International Large Fund for Nature South Africa (WWF SA) not too long ago teamed as much as pilot the usage of a era to safeguard marine mammals in opposition to entanglement.

Picture: Glenneis Kriel
Bokamoso Lebepe, who coordinates the Marine Stewardship Council’s Fish for Just right Venture of WWF SA, got here up with the theory to create the factitious intelligence-based resolution that uses cameras and hydrophones to observe whales and turn on an emergency reaction after a whale died in 2020 when it were given entangled with a mussel fishing rope close to North Bay inside the Aquaculture Construction Zone in Saldanha.
The early-warning machine may also be used to assemble clinical knowledge through recording the motion of marine lifestyles and may just lend a hand to forestall send moves for different tremendous pods, reminiscent of seals and dolphins.
The answer shall be piloted within the Saldanha Bay Aquaculture Construction Zone, and then it’ll be rolled out to different coastal spaces and fisheries.
“We determined to pilot it in Saldanha as a result of it’s the simplest position in South Africa the place mussels are grown, and since we didn’t need the mussel farming trade to grow to be related to whale entanglement,” Lebepe stated.
Vos Pienaar, a mussel produce and marine biologist, instructed Farmer’s Weekly that mussels may just simplest be produced in Saldanha alongside the South African coast as it was once the one space providing waters that had been sufficiently nutrient wealthy and secure from the open sea.
Mussel farming took off across the Eighties in South Africa and lately 4 manufacturers landed about 3 500t of mussels in step with yr. To place this in viewpoint, global manufacturing averages round two million heaps in step with yr.
The South African mussel trade employs 60 other people at sea and some other 400 within the downstream mussel-processing factories the place mussels are cooked and frozen, basically for the native catering marketplace.
Pienaar stated that whale entanglement was once no longer an issue within the shallower spaces of Saldanha, that means probabilities had been nearly non-existent that whales would come close to farms on this space.
The chance was once a lot larger in open, deeper water, the place the mussels are grown on ropes that may stretch over masses of metres lengthy.
“The Division of Forestry, Fisheries and the Atmosphere has made 800ha of unfarmed ocean to be had for aquaculture to stimulate manufacturing. I don’t assume that some portions of this ocean, close to Large Bay and North Bay, are fitted to mussel farming, and worry that those spaces pose a top chance of whale entanglement.”
Vodacom has allotted R3,5 million in step with yr for the following 3 years against the partnership settlement. The machine has no longer but been put in, as technical specs reminiscent of the location on antennas and hydrophones are nonetheless being evaluated.
